World Ozone Day 2026: India Launches Net Zero Portal and NAPCC Dashboard

Date:

New Delhi: On the occasion of World Ozone Day 2026, Kirti Vardhan Singh, Union Minister of State for Environment, Forest and Climate Change, launched the ‘India Net Zero’ Portal and the National Action Plan on Climate Change (NAPCC) Dashboard on Today. These digital platforms aim to make climate action in the country more transparent, coordinated, and evidence-based.

Through the Net Zero portal, entities from various sectors will be able to voluntarily register and disclose their net-zero targets. This platform will enable them to share information regarding their gre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ions, set net-zero goals, and provide annual updates on their progress. Meanwhile, the NAPCC dashboard will facilitate the integrated monitoring of progress across national missions related to climate change.

Entities are encouraged to report Scope 1 and Scope 2 emissions data on the Net Zero portal, while Scope 3 disclosure remains voluntary. On the portal, entities will also be able to share their strategies for achieving net-zero targets through clean energy, energy efficiency, technological measures, and carbon removal.

According to the government, this initiative will enhance transparency in voluntary climate efforts and encourage long-term planning. Entities announcing net-zero targets will receive official acknowledgment from the Ministry of Environment. A public record of these announcements will also be available on the portal.

The portal can be available at netzeroindia.moef.gov.in.

The NAPCC dashboard will provide information regarding the progress and implementation of various national missions under the National Action Plan on Climate Change on a single digital platform. It incorporates key data and defined indicators related to the missions, enabling ministries and departments to systematically monitor the schemes.

The dashboard will facilitate better inter-ministerial coordination, enable fact-based assessment of climate action, and allow for the monitoring of sector-wise progress. It will help identify implementation gaps and link India’s domestic climate action with its international commitments.

The dashboard is available at napccindia.moef.gov.in.

The launch of the Net Zero Portal and NAPCC Dashboard marks a step forward in India’s efforts to strengthen climate governance through technology, transparency and institutional coordination. The platforms are expected to facilitate data-driven decision-making, improve monitoring of climate action and support broader participation in the country’s transition towards a low-carbon and climate-resilient future.
